Understanding Iron: Types and Functions

When you think about essential nutrients, iron often comes to mind due to its important role in the body. Iron exists in two main forms: heme and non-heme. Heme iron, found in animal products, is more easily absorbed by your body. Non-heme iron, present in plant foods, requires a bit more effort for absorption.

Iron’s primary function is to facilitate oxygen transport in your red blood cells, which is critical for energy production. It also plays a role in DNA synthesis and immune function. Deficiency can lead to anemia, resulting in fatigue and weakened immunity. To maintain adequate iron levels, it’s necessary to understand these types and their functions, ensuring your diet supports ideal health.

Top Animal-Based Sources of Iron

Animal-based sources of iron are essential for those looking to boost their iron intake efficiently. Red meat, particularly beef and lamb, is among the richest sources, providing heme iron, which your body absorbs more effectively than non-heme iron from plants. Poultry, such as chicken and turkey, also offers considerable amounts of heme iron, particularly in dark meat. Fish and shellfish, especially oysters, clams, and sardines, are excellent choices, delivering high iron levels along with beneficial omega-3 fatty acids. Organ meats, like liver, are incredibly nutrient-dense and packed with iron. Incorporating these foods into your diet can greatly enhance your iron status and support overall health. Remember, cooking meat in cast iron cookware can further increase the iron content of your meals.

Best Plant-Based Sources of Iron

While animal-based sources provide highly absorbable heme iron, plant-based foods also offer valuable options for those seeking to increase their iron intake. Legumes such as lentils, chickpeas, and beans are excellent choices, delivering significant non-heme iron. Dark leafy greens like spinach and kale also contribute, though their oxalate content can inhibit absorption. Quinoa and fortified cereals can boost your iron levels, making them ideal for breakfast or side dishes. Nuts and seeds, particularly pumpkin seeds and cashews, are another great source. Combining these foods with iron enhancers, like whole grains or vitamin C-rich fruits, can further improve absorption. Make sure to incorporate these options into your diet for peak iron intake.

Vitamin C-Rich Foods

Incorporating vitamin C-rich foods into your diet greatly boosts the absorption of non-heme iron from plant sources. Research shows that vitamin C enhances iron uptake by converting ferric iron to the more absorbable ferrous form. Foods high in vitamin C include citrus fruits, strawberries, bell peppers, and broccoli. When you consume these foods alongside iron-rich plant sources like lentils or spinach, you markedly improve your body’s ability to absorb the iron. This synergistic effect is essential, especially for individuals relying on plant-based diets. By prioritizing vitamin C in your meals, you can maximize iron absorption, helping to prevent deficiencies and support overall health. Remember, pairing these foods is key to optimizing your nutrient intake effectively.

Foods to Avoid When Consuming Iron

Although iron is essential for your health, certain foods can hinder its absorption, making it crucial to be mindful of your diet. Calcium-rich foods, like dairy products, compete with iron for absorption, so it’s best to consume them separately. Additionally, phytates found in whole grains, legumes, and some seeds can reduce iron bioavailability. Tannins in tea and coffee also inhibit iron absorption, so consider limiting these beverages during meals. High-fiber foods may slow down iron uptake, so moderation is key. Finally, oxalates present in spinach and beet greens can bind to iron, making it less available for your body to use. By avoiding these foods at the same time as your iron-rich meals, you’ll improve your iron absorption considerably.

Cooking Methods That Enhance Iron Availability

Cooking methods greatly impact the availability of iron in foods, so selecting the right techniques can enhance your mineral intake. For instance, cooking in cast iron pans can increase the iron content of your food, especially acidic dishes like tomato sauce. Steaming vegetables is another effective method, as it retains more nutrients compared to boiling. Additionally, pairing iron-rich foods with vitamin C sources, like bell peppers or citrus, can considerably boost iron absorption. On the other hand, avoid overcooking, which can diminish nutrient levels, and be cautious with high-calcium foods consumed simultaneously, as calcium competes with iron for absorption. By using these methods, you can maximize the iron benefits from your meals effectively.

The Role of Iron Supplements: When and How to Use Them

When considering how to maintain adequate iron levels, iron supplements can be a valuable addition for certain individuals, especially those at risk of deficiency. If you’re pregnant, menstruating heavily, or following a vegetarian or vegan diet, your iron needs may increase. To use iron supplements effectively, consult a healthcare professional for personalized advice and appropriate dosage. It’s essential to choose between ferrous sulfate, ferrous gluconate, or ferrous fumarate, as their absorption rates vary. Taking supplements with vitamin C can enhance absorption, while calcium or antacids may hinder it. Monitor for side effects, such as gastrointestinal discomfort, and adjust as needed. Regularly check your iron levels to guarantee you’re on the right track and avoid potential toxicity from excessive intake.

Frequently Asked Questions

Can Excessive Iron Intake Be Harmful to Health?

Yes, excessive iron intake can be harmful to your health. It may lead to conditions like hemochromatosis, liver damage, and increased risk of diabetes. Always consult a healthcare professional before notably increasing your iron consumption.

How Does Caffeine Affect Iron Absorption?

Caffeine reduces iron absorption, so if you drink coffee with breakfast, you might hinder iron intake from your iron-rich meal. Studies show that caffeine can inhibit non-heme iron absorption, impacting overall iron status.

Are There Any Genetic Factors Influencing Iron Levels?

Yes, genetic factors can influence your iron levels. Variations in genes like HFE affect iron absorption and metabolism, potentially leading to conditions like hemochromatosis or iron deficiency, impacting your overall health and nutritional needs.

What Are the Symptoms of Iron Overload?

You might experience fatigue, joint pain, abdominal discomfort, or irregular heart rhythms due to iron overload. Skin changes, such as a bronze tint, can also occur. Monitoring your iron levels is vital to prevent these symptoms.

Can Cooking With Cast Iron Increase Dietary Iron?

Yes, cooking with cast iron can increase dietary iron intake. Acidic foods, like tomatoes, enhance iron leaching from the cookware, potentially boosting your iron consumption. However, the exact amount varies based on cooking time and food type.
